1982 United States Senate election in Massachusetts

The 1982 United States Senate election in Massachusetts was held on November 2, 1982. Incumbent Democratic U.S. Senator Ted Kennedy won re-election to his fifth (his fourth full) term.

  • Howard S. Katz (Libertarian)
  • Ted Kennedy, incumbent U.S. Senator since 1962 (Democratic)
  • Ray Shamie, metalwork entrepreneur (Republican)
